e69325305b
When introducing heap type decoding we added some module-specific checks to the constructor of certain immediates. This broke the previous design where module-specific checks were done in a separate {Validate} method. This CL restores that state. R=jkummerow@chromium.org Change-Id: I1ed887daecc25990272c95a24f4444da2d8b5466 Reviewed-on: https://chromium-review.googlesource.com/c/v8/v8/+/4008318 Commit-Queue: Clemens Backes <clemensb@chromium.org> Reviewed-by: Jakob Kummerow <jkummerow@chromium.org> Cr-Commit-Position: refs/heads/main@{#84118} |
||
---|---|---|
.. | ||
wasm | ||
assembler-tester.h | ||
c-signature.h | ||
call-tester.h | ||
code-assembler-tester.h | ||
DEPS | ||
flag-utils.h | ||
node-observer-tester.h | ||
types-fuzz.h | ||
value-helper.cc | ||
value-helper.h |